Career path

Career Role (Data Analysis in Health Advocacy, UK) Description
Health Data Analyst Analyze health data to inform advocacy strategies, focusing on public health initiatives and policy impact. Requires strong data visualization and statistical analysis skills.
Public Health Data Scientist Develop predictive models and algorithms to forecast health trends and optimize resource allocation for disease prevention and health promotion. Deep expertise in statistical modeling and machine learning crucial.
Health Informatics Specialist Manage and interpret large health datasets, ensuring data integrity and security. Strong database management skills and data governance knowledge are essential.
Biostatistician (Health Advocacy) Apply statistical methods to evaluate the effectiveness of health interventions and inform evidence-based advocacy campaigns. Requires advanced statistical knowledge and clinical trial experience.
